ObamaCare Architect: Catholic Institutions Should Provide Birth Control as Moral Imperative to Stop Population Growth
by Joel B. Pollak Robert CreamerDemocrat strategist, Obama 2008 campaign aide, and political architect of ObamaCareargues that the new contraceptive mandate for Catholic institutions isnt really about equality for women, or religious liberty.
Rather, it is about population control.
Creamerlike his wife, the pro-abortion Rep. Jan Schakowsky (D-IL)embraces the left-wing fallacy that children are a burden on the planet, which the state should encourage the churchand everyone elseto limit.
At 6:16-7:03 in the video below, by CNS News, Schakowsky describes abortion as most often a responsible decision to control the size of their families:
Writing in the Huffington Post yesterday, Creamer declared:
[T]here is a worldwide consensus that the use of birth control is one of societys most important moral priorities. Far from being something that should be discouraged, or is controversial, the use of birth control is critical to the survival and success of humanity .It is simply not possible for this small planet to sustain that kind of exponential human population growth. If we do, the result will be poverty, war, the depletion of our natural resources and famine. Fundamentally, the Reverend [Thomas] Malthus was rightexcept that the result is not inevitable .Thats why it is our moral imperative to act responsibly and encourage each other to use birth control.
Malthuss late eighteenth and early nineteenth-century views, which still inspire much of todays environmental movement, have been repeatedly disproved over the course of two centuries. Economic freedom, growth and innovation have made human society vastly more productive and efficient.
It is precisely because radical socialists like Creamer, Schakowsky and Obama detest the free economy that they continue to rely on old Malthusian and Marxist ideas.
Regardless, the indication by Creamer that the contraception mandate is not about equality, but population growth, suggests that the Obama administrations challenge to the beliefs of the Catholic church may be more directand deliberatethan was previously suspected.
